Patience is a virtue--especially if their is food on the line!
Oshie is an Australian Shepherd (one of the more under-appreciated dogs on the internet!) hungry for some snacks, but it appears that her owner Sara has trained her to hold back on scarfing them down until given permission to do so. Many dogs nowadays are trained to go through a performance routine before they are finally rewarded with a treat, but to have the food waved in your face like this? It's gotta be tough!
Fortunately, Oshie is a good boy and can demonstrate some discipline, remaining completely still while Sara stacks a tower of snacks on his head, and only moves when he is finally allowed to eat!
